About EastView HealthCare & Rehabilitation Center

EastView HealthCare & Rehabilitation Center is located in East Houston and serves as a location for both short-term rehabilitation and long-term nursing care. The staff works with residents, their families, and healthcare providers to build a comprehensive and effective care and treatment plan tailored to each individual.

Nursing staff provide round-the-clock care for residents under the direction of in-house physicians. The center combines clinical therapeutic approaches with hands-on methods, offering rehabilitation programs designed for both short-term recovery and longer-term care needs.

Residents can take part in a variety of daily activities, with a monthly activity calendar filled with options intended to keep individuals engaged and active throughout the day.

The center emphasizes a comfortable, safe, and therapeutic environment, aiming to help residents regain strength and mobility while feeling at home during their stay.

Government Inspection History

5 inspection visits in the last three years, 17 citations on file. Inspections are conducted by state agencies on behalf of the U.S.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S).

Feb 24, 2026Health Complaint1 citation
  • Post nurse staffing information every day.

    Severity C of L: potential for minimal harm, widespreadFound during a complaint inspectionCorrected Mar 23, 2026

Dec 18, 2025Fire Safety StandardHealth Standard7 citations
  • Install corridor and hallway doors that block smoke.

    Severity E of L: no actual harm, potential for more than minimal harm, patternCorrected Dec 19, 2025

  • Ensure smoke barriers are constructed to a 1 hour fire resistance rating.

    Severity E of L: no actual harm, potential for more than minimal harm, patternCorrected Dec 19, 2025

  • Keep aisles, corridors, and exits free of obstruction in case of emergency.

    Severity E of L: no actual harm, potential for more than minimal harm, patternCorrected Dec 19, 2025

  • Develop and implement policies and procedures to prevent abuse, neglect, and theft.

    Severity E of L: no actual harm, potential for more than minimal harm, patternCorrected Jan 19, 2026

  • Provide care and assistance to perform activities of daily living for any resident who is unable.

    Severity D of L: no actual harm, potential for more than minimal harm, isolatedCorrected Jan 19, 2026

  • Provide pharmaceutical services to meet the needs of each resident and employ or obtain the services of a licensed pharmacist.

    Severity D of L: no actual harm, potential for more than minimal harm, isolatedCorrected Jan 19, 2026

  • Dispose of garbage and refuse properly.

    Severity D of L: no actual harm, potential for more than minimal harm, isolatedCorrected Jan 19, 2026

Sep 19, 2024Fire Safety StandardHealth Standard2 citations
  • Ensure precautions for handling oxygen cylinders and equipment are correctly followed.

    Severity E of L: no actual harm, potential for more than minimal harm, patternCorrected Sep 30, 2024

  • Ensure that feeding tubes are not used unless there is a medical reason and the resident agrees; and provide appropriate care for a resident with a feeding tube.

    Severity D of L: no actual harm, potential for more than minimal harm, isolatedCorrected Oct 11, 2024

Apr 25, 2024Health Complaint1 citation
  • Ensure drugs and biologicals used in the facility are labeled in accordance with currently accepted professional principles; and all drugs and biologicals must be stored in locked compartments, separately locked, compartments for controlled drugs.

    Severity D of L: no actual harm, potential for more than minimal harm, isolatedFound during a complaint inspectionCorrected May 17, 2024

Aug 18, 2023Fire Safety StandardHealth Standard6 citations
  • Provide properly protected cooking facilities.

    Severity E of L: no actual harm, potential for more than minimal harm, patternCorrected Aug 21, 2023

  • Procure food from sources approved or considered satisfactory and store, prepare, distribute and serve food in accordance with professional standards.

    Severity E of L: no actual harm, potential for more than minimal harm, patternCorrected Sep 15, 2023

  • Provide and implement an infection prevention and control program.

    Severity E of L: no actual harm, potential for more than minimal harm, patternCorrected Sep 15, 2023

  • Make sure there is a pest control program to prevent/deal with mice, insects, or other pests.

    Severity E of L: no actual harm, potential for more than minimal harm, patternCorrected Sep 15, 2023

  • Keep aisles, corridors, and exits free of obstruction in case of emergency.

    Severity E of L: no actual harm, potential for more than minimal harm, patternCorrected Aug 21, 2023

  • Ensure drugs and biologicals used in the facility are labeled in accordance with currently accepted professional principles; and all drugs and biologicals must be stored in locked compartments, separately locked, compartments for controlled drugs.

    Severity D of L: no actual harm, potential for more than minimal harm, isolatedCorrected Sep 15, 2023

Source: CMS Care Compare, public federal data covering certified nursing facilities, refreshed monthly. Citations range from A (least serious) to L (most serious) on the federal scope and severity scale.
